Latest Patents
Julius Staffer holds a patent for a **Device for drying printed sheets on offset printing presses**. This innovative device comprises infrared radiators strategically positioned above the delivery pile of printed sheets. The design allows the infrared radiators to be displaced from a rest position into a working position directly above the sheets. Furthermore, the device includes functionality to replace the infrared radiators with blowers, enabling a change in the mode of operation, thereby improving the drying process of printed sheets.
